  • Title

    Design of Triplexing Coupler Based on 2D Photonic Crystals with FTTH Function

  • Abstract
    We propose a new add-drop filters based on two dimensional photonic crystals (PCs). The structure consists of two PC waveguides and a resonant cavity system. We devise a triplexing coupler by 2D-FDTD method calculation, and the three wavelengths dropping efficiency are higher than 85% and the crosstalk are smaller than -28.6 dB.
